Is 30 Mbps Good for Gaming? Causes of Lag and How to Improve It
A 30 Mbps connection is usually sufficient for online gaming because most games use relatively little bandwidth during play. However, download speed alone does not determine gaming quality. High latency, unstable Wi-Fi, packet loss, network congestion, background downloads, and slow upload performance can still cause lag, rubber-banding, or disconnects. This guide explains why these problems occur, how to measure the relevant network conditions, and which practical changes can improve gameplay. It also covers when 30 Mbps may be insufficient, especially when several people stream, download large files, or use cloud services at the same time.
30 Mbps is generally good enough for online gaming when the connection is stable and latency is low. Most multiplayer games do not require a large amount of bandwidth after the game has loaded. The connection may still feel poor if it has high ping, packet loss, unstable Wi-Fi, or heavy traffic from other devices.
What 30 Mbps Means for Gaming
Download speed describes how quickly data can arrive from the internet. It affects game downloads, updates, and streaming more than the basic responsiveness of a multiplayer session. A 30 Mbps connection can support online play, voice chat, and ordinary web use, but large downloads will take longer than they would on a faster fiber or cable broadband plan.
Gaming performance depends more on latency, jitter, packet loss, and connection stability. A lower-speed connection with consistent latency can feel better than a faster connection that frequently fluctuates.
Why Gaming Can Lag on a 30 Mbps Connection
High latency to the game server
Latency is the time required for data to travel between your device and the game server. A distant server, inefficient ISP routing, or network congestion can produce high ping even when a speed test shows 30 Mbps. High latency causes delayed actions, slow hit registration, and visible rubber-banding.
Unstable Wi-Fi interference
Wi-Fi interference from neighboring networks, walls, appliances, or crowded wireless channels can make packets arrive late or require retransmission. This creates inconsistent gameplay rather than simply reducing the advertised download speed. A wired Ethernet connection is often the clearest way to check whether Wi-Fi is the source of the problem.
Packet loss and connection errors
Packet loss occurs when data fails to reach its destination and must be sent again. It can result from a weak wireless signal, a faulty cable, modem problems, ISP faults, or congestion. Even a small amount of packet loss can cause character movement to jump, commands to be ignored, or players to disconnect.
Other devices using the connection
Streaming video, cloud backups, large downloads, and software updates can consume available bandwidth while you play. These activities may also increase latency when the router has to manage a full upload or download queue. The problem is more likely in a household where several users share the same connection.
Insufficient upload capacity
Online games send player actions, voice data, and status information upstream. This traffic is usually modest, but a saturated upload connection can cause severe delay. Cloud photo synchronization, live streaming, security cameras, and file transfers are common reasons for high upload usage.
Slow or overloaded network hardware
An older modem, router, Ethernet cable, or network adapter can introduce instability. Router processor limits, outdated firmware, overheating, or a poorly placed device may also affect performance. Hardware problems can appear as intermittent lag even when the ISP speed is close to the expected rate.
How to Check Whether 30 Mbps Is Enough
- Run a speed test over Ethernet if possible and record download speed, upload speed, ping, and test consistency.
- Test at different times of day to identify peak-hour congestion.
- Check the game interface for server ping, packet loss, and network warnings.
- Repeat the test while no one is streaming, downloading, or backing up files.
- Compare Wi-Fi results with a wired connection from the same room or device.
- Use the game server region closest to your physical location when the game allows server selection.
There is no universal ping threshold for every game, but lower and more stable latency is generally preferable. For competitive games, consistency and packet loss often matter more than increasing download speed from 30 Mbps to a much higher tier.
Ways to Improve Gaming on 30 Mbps
- Connect the gaming PC or console directly to the router with Ethernet.
- Place the router in an open, central position and keep it away from interference sources.
- Use a less crowded Wi-Fi channel and the appropriate 5 GHz or 6 GHz band when supported.
- Pause large downloads, cloud backups, and automatic updates during gaming sessions.
- Enable a router quality-of-service feature to prioritize gaming traffic when available.
- Restart and update the modem and router, and replace damaged cables.
- Choose a nearby game server region and avoid using a VPN unless it improves routing in a measured test.
When 30 Mbps May Not Be Enough
30 Mbps may feel insufficient when multiple devices share the connection, especially if several people stream high-resolution video or download large files at the same time. It may also be limiting for households that need fast game updates, frequent cloud backups, or simultaneous live streaming. In these cases, a faster plan can provide more capacity, but it will not automatically fix high latency caused by distance, Wi-Fi interference, packet loss, or poor ISP routing.
Bottom Line
For most single-player and multiplayer gaming, 30 Mbps is adequate. Focus first on ping, jitter, packet loss, upload saturation, and Wi-Fi stability. If the connection remains unstable over Ethernet at different times, contact your ISP and provide test results. A local ISP may be able to check line quality, modem signal levels, routing, or service congestion before you decide whether a faster plan is necessary.
